A400 - Projetistas e Consultores de Engenharia
A400 renders technical services in several fields of engineering. Founded in 1995 the company has grown steadily throughout the years and now relies on the expertise of over 90 employees both in Portugal and the African Continent. With the head office in Portugal and branches in Angola, Mozambique, Morocco and Algeria, A400 offers both expertise and experience in several fields of engineering.
